  4. Humans aren’t meant to be exposed to the amount of stimulation the modern world brings. Which is why the Stoics advise us to exercise the virtue of moderation.
  5. Moderation means not overdoing things nor underdoing them. Remember you can stay happy as long as there are no corresponding pains according to Epicurus. The wise man drinks a little to attain pleasure but not so much as he will cause himself a hangover (Pain).
